Source: Hueiyen News Service
Imphal, May 26 2009:
A course to train sixteen 'Health Angels' was inaugurated by Mrs Madhu Gurung, President of Army Wives Welfare Assocation (AWWA) Red Shield at 357 Field Hospital yesterday, a PIB (Defence Wing) statement informed.
In her inaugural speech, Mrs Madhu Gurung emphasized the important role these girls will be expected to play in the up-liftment of their society and the responsibility associated with it.

As they have volunteered to be part of the noble profession, she advised the trainees to apply themselves in the right earnest for the benefit of their own society.
This course being a premier initiative by the Army of its kind in the region, it is expected that the trainees will deliver the faith reposed in them.
She also interacted with the trainees and joined them for tea.
The statement further informed that the "Health Angels"�an initiative by Red Shield Division of the Indian Army and brainchild of Mrs Madhu Gurung, President AWWA Red Shield is an earnest endeavour to imbibe basic health awareness and maternity training amongst literate village folk to empower them and enable their knowledge and skill to percolate down to the grass root level and benefit the population of rural villages from which they come and where no medical aid is available.
The responsibility of training these sixteen educated girls from the villages and hamlets of general area Leimakhong who have volunteered to undergo the course of twelve weeks has been undertaken by the Red Shield medical officers who will impart the required theoretical and practical training to these health angels.
After having successfully undergone the training, each of these trained girls will be armed with a health kit consisting of basic medicines and medical equipments for routine health and ante natal check ups.
Arrangements will also be made for replenishment of the health kit from time to time.
During the period of training the volunteer girls will be provided with the required stationeries for the course and afternoon meals.
